使用boost::fusion::none的C++测试程序
Boost Fusion是一个用于C++的库,提供了一组用于操作元组和序列的工具。其中,boost::fusion::none是一个非常有用的函数,用于检查序列中是否没有任何元素满足特定的条件。在本文中,我们将编写一个简单的测试程序,演示boost::fusion::none的用法。
首先,我们需要确保已经安装了Boost库。然后,我们将创建一个C++源文件,命名为fusion_none_test.cpp,并包含所需的头文件。
#include <iostream>
#include <boost/fusion/include/none.hpp>
#include <boost/fusion/include/vector.hpp></